/*
|
||||
* Passwords are stored in a node that is selected by system type id.
|
||||
* Each password has a key that consists of a host name and a user id pair.
|
||||
* The key is a string and looks like <hostName>//<userId>.
|
||||
* Host names may be symbolic or they be IPv4 or IPv6 addresses.
|
||||
* The current design treats these the same.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* In addition to the registered system types, there is a "default" system type
|
||||
* that can be searched if a password is not found for a registered system type.
|
||||
* The API allows for setting this default along with a particular system type.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* The current implementation uses Equinox secure storage. The
|
||||
* API for this looks like that for a preferences store. This is arranged as a tree
|
||||
* of nodes, each node holding a set of keyed values.
|
||||
* In the case of this password store value reside only at the lowest
|
||||
* nodes in the tree. There is one node for each system type, which is then used to
|
||||
* store passwords for a particular host name, user ID pair.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* This is similar to the previous implementation which used the Eclipse platform key ring.
|
||||
* A particular key ring node was selected using the system type id and a Map object
|
||||
* was retrieved or stored at this node. The map was keyed by the same host name, user ID
|
||||
* pair that is used in the current implementation.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Migration from the old implementation to the new one is done when accessing a node for
|
||||
* the first time. At that point the map entries present in the old implementation are copied
|
||||
* to the preferences node in the new implementation.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* The old key ring values can be migrated only if they can be accessed using the
|
||||
* compatibility API found in the bundle org.eclipse.core.runtime.compatability.auth.
|
||||
* This can be installed by the user, but is not included in the standard
|
||||
* packaging for Eclipse 4.2 and subsequent releases.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* The nodes in the old implementation were rooted in the URL file://rse<username> where <username>
|
||||
* was the name of the java user.name system property. Note that this user.name property may be,
|
||||
* and probably is, different that the user ID used on a target system. The new secure preferences are rooted
|
||||
* in the default secure preferences node which is kept in a location associated with
|
||||
* the current user. Thus, there is no need to additionally qualify the secure
|
||||
* storage location with the user.name system property.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Lookup is based on an exact match followed by a fuzzy match on host names. An exact match
|
||||
* uses the host name argument as is and is case sensitive when matching the host name of the
|
||||
* stored keys. If not found, then a fuzzy match is employed that allows for case insensitivity.
|
||||
* If one host name is a prefix of the other and they both resolve to the name network entity they
|
||||
* are considered to be matching. Network name resolution is very expensive and is employed only if their
|
||||
* is enough extra similar information to justify a match. Thus, for example, hobbiton could
|
||||
* match HOBBITON.EXAMPLE.COM, but could never match an IP address.
|
||||
*/
